Journal Entry: 18th March 2012

Today we went to Strawberry Hill House with our costumes ready for the technical rehearsal. It was important and beneficial to attend this as we met the newly- cast dancers for the first time and had chance to carry out any fittings before the dress rehearsal tomorrow.
The entire project is very exciting, and it was amazing to work alongside actors who are passionate about their costumes. Creative and practical solutions were carried out when collaborating with the lead actor, Leigh Stevenson regarding the Mad Monk's costume. It was useful to gain another perspective on the costume, from an actor's point of view. We really valued his opinions and appreciated his enthusiasm!
At the location, we have been provided with a dressing/ work room, which we have organised in a successful and efficient way.
As well as being in control of costumes, we hold responsibility of props and make-up, which combined, makes this a truly unique experience.
